BRICS 2026: Modi Seeks Bigger Role For Global South

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i addressed the BRICS summit, proposing a new agenda for the next 20 years and advocating for a greater role for the Global South in global decision-making. He suggested establishing a BRICS continuity and implementation mechanism to track initiatives and outcomes, and a secure repository for decisions. Modi also called for jointly formulating ten proposals for global governance reform to create a BRICS reform roadmap by the next summit.

WHY IT MATTERS

Modi's proposals aim to shift the balance of power in global governance, giving developing nations a more significant voice and stake in international policy and decision-making processes.
